Your dividends can be paid directly into a UK bank or building society account, by:
completing a simple form securely online
calling the BT Shareholder Helpline on Freefone 0808 100 4141, (for UK individual shareholders with up to 1,500 shares), or
completing a dividend payment form (this method is needed if the shares are held in joint names, or in the name of a company) and sending it to Equiniti*.
Direct bank or building society payments mean your dividends are paid using BACS - an automated payment system. Your dividend will be paid into your bank or building society account, on BT's dividend payment date, without any delay.
Any information you provide will not be shared with any third parties. Your information is held, as part of your shareholder account details, by Equiniti*.
To set up your direct payment instruction online, you will need:
an Access Number and Password - which you will have if you have registered for the BT e-communication service - ShareholderPlus, or the Equiniti* Shareview service
the name of your bank or building society
your bank or building society sort code
your bank or building society account number

To set up your direct payment instruction by phone or by post, you will also need your shareholder reference number: an 8-character reference printed below your name and address on your dividend tax voucher, and on your share certificate or Easyshare statement.
